Transaction 629448399490dafc3bc82f78c271cb4986f582f827d1e7b88c558f94db816ac2
1 Input
1 Output
-
629448399490dafc3bc82f78c271cb4986f582f827d1e7b88c558f94db816ac2:0
- value
- 628000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 02ba8fec605b27528b8dc4a7dd1b626ee29ad244 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1FRqxFZjpx5gbvcS52bxaW6rEuv4bAUpD